What is the U.S. Figure Skating Membership Registration?
The U.S. Figure Skating Membership Registration is a crucial form designed for individuals wishing to register as skaters or instructors within the U.S. Figure Skating Basic Skills Program. This registration not only captures essential personal information, such as the individual's name, date of birth, and contact details, but also ensures a pathway for skaters to engage in various activities and events in the U.S. Figure Skating community. Completing this registration form establishes a foundation for participants to access various member benefits.

How to fill out the Skating Registration
-
1.Access the U.S. Figure Skating Membership Registration form on pdfFiller by navigating to the website and searching for the form in the search bar.
-
2.Once located, click on the form to open it in the pdfFiller editor. You will see the fillable fields prominently displayed within the form.
-
3.Before starting, gather all necessary information, including personal details like your name, address, date of birth, and contact information. Have your parent's or guardian's details ready if you are underage.
-
4.Begin filling in the form by clicking on the 'NAME:' field and typing in your full name. Move on to the 'ADDRESS:' field and enter your current residence.
-
5.Continue by completing the 'CITY:', 'STATE:', and 'ZIP:' fields. Use the dropdown menus for state options if necessary.
-
6.Fill in the 'TELEPHONE (HOME):' field with your primary contact number, ensuring it is accurate for communication purposes.
-
7.Next, enter your 'DATE OF BIRTH:' in the designated format. Select your 'GENDER:' from the options provided.
-
8.Input your 'E-MAIL:' address to receive updates and communications related to your membership.
-
9.In the 'PROGRAM NAME:' field, specify which program you are registering for, ensuring it is correct.
-
10.Review all filled fields carefully to ensure accuracy and completeness before proceeding to the next step.
-
11.Once complete, look for the 'Save' option on pdfFiller to keep a digital copy of your filled form.
-
12.Consider using the ‘Download’ feature to save the completed form as a PDF file to your device.
-
13.For submission, check the required procedures specified by U.S. Figure Skating, which may include attaching the form in an email or mailing it directly.
Who is eligible to fill out the U.S. Figure Skating Membership Registration form?
Eligibility to fill out this form includes individuals wishing to register as skaters or instructors in the U.S. Figure Skating Basic Skills Program. Parents or guardians can also complete the form on behalf of minors.
Is there a deadline for submitting the membership registration form?
While specific deadlines can vary by season or program, it’s recommended to submit your registration form well in advance of scheduled events or competitions to ensure participation.
How do I submit the U.S. Figure Skating Membership Registration form once completed?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can submit it by following the directions provided by U.S. Figure Skating. This may involve emailing the completed form or mailing it to the specified address.
What supporting documents are needed with the membership registration form?
Typically, no additional documents are required beyond the completed form itself. However, verify with U.S. Figure Skating in case any specific documents are needed.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Avoid leaving any fields blank, ensuring all required information is filled out completely. Double-check for accuracy in your contact details and program name to prevent issues.
How long does it take for my registration to be processed?
Processing times can vary, but expect a few weeks for your membership registration form to be reviewed and processed. Check with U.S. Figure Skating for their specific timelines.
